计算机网络课本习题_第1页
计算机网络课本习题_第2页
计算机网络课本习题_第3页
计算机网络课本习题_第4页
计算机网络课本习题_第5页
已阅读5页,还剩34页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

习题解答1-10试在下列条件下比较电路交换和分组交换。要传送的报文共x(bit)。从源站到目的站共经过k段链路,每段链路的传播时延为d(s),数据率为b(b/s)。在电路交换时电路的建立时间为S(s)。在分组交换时分组长度为p(bit),且各结点的排队等待时间可忽略不计。问在怎样的条件下,分组交换的时延比电路交换的要小?解:对于电路交换t1=s+x/b+kd

对于分组交换总的延迟为t2=x/b+(k-1)p/b+kd

为了分组交换的时延比电路交换的要小则:t1>t2

所以:s>(k-1)p/bP1P2P3P4P1P2P3P4P3P4ABCDABCD电路交换分组交换t连接建立数据传送报文P2P1连接释放x/bd1-19长度为100字节的应用层数据交给运输层传送,需加上20字节的TCP首部。再交给网络层传送,需加上20字节的IP首部。最后交给数据链路层的以太网传送,加上首部和尾部共18字节。试求数据的传输效率。数据的传输效率是指发送的应用层数据除以所发送的总数据。若应用层数据长度为1000字节,数据的传输效率是多少?解:100/(100+20+20+18)

1000/(1000+20+20+18)2-07假定某信道受奈氏准则限制的最高码元速率为20000码元/秒。如果采用振幅调制,把码元的振幅划分为16个不同等级来传送,那么可以获得多高的数据率?

解:16=24

即1码元携带4比特信息量

数据率为20000×4=80000(b/s)2-16共有四个站进行码分多址通信。四个站的码片序列为:A(-1-1-1+1+1-1+1+1)B(-1-1+1-1+1+1+1-1)C(-1+1-1+1+1+1-1-1)D(-1+1-1-1-1-1+1-1)现收到这样的码片序列:S(-1+1-3+1-1-3+1+1),问那个站发送数据了?发送数据的站发送的1还是0?(-1+1-3+1-1-3+1+1)·(-1-1-1+1+1-1+1+1)/8=1(-1+1-3+1-1-3+1+1)·(-1-1+1-1+1+1+1-1)/8=-1(-1+1-3+1-1-3+1+1)·(-1+1-1+1+1+1-1-1)/8=0(-1+1-3+1-1-3+1+1)·(-1+1-1-1-1-1+1-1)/8=1根据计算结果:A和D发送比特1,B发送比特0,C没有发送数据

3-07要发送的数据为1101011011.P(X)=X4+X+1.

解答:添加的检验序列(即余数)为1110(11010110110000

除以10011)

数据在传输过程中最后一个1变成了0,11010110101110除以10011,余数为011,不为0,接收端可以发现差错。

数据在传输过程中最后两个1都变成了0,11010110001110除以10011,余数为101,不为0,接收端可以发现差错。

3-07要发送的数据为101110。P(X)=X3+1.求应添加在数据后面的余数。

被除数:101110000除数:10013-10解答:要传送的比特串

0110111111111100零比特填充后

011011111011111000

接收到的比特串为

001110111110111110110

还原为00111011111111111103-16数据率为10Mbps的以太网在物理媒体上的码元传输速率是多少?解答:以太网使用曼彻斯特编码,这就意味着发送的每一码元中间都有一个电压的转换。每秒传送的码元数加倍了。标准以太网的数据速率是10Mb/s,因此波特率是数据率的两倍,即20M波特。

基带数字信号曼彻斯特编码

码元1111100000出现电平转换3-20假定1km长的CSMA/CD网络的数据率为1Gbps,设信号在网络上的传播速率为200000km/s,求能够使用此协议的最短帧长。解答:对于1km电缆,单程端到端传播时延为:τ=1÷200000=5×10-6s=5μs,

端到端往返时延为:2τ=10μs

为了能按照CSMA/CD工作,最小帧的发送时延不能小于10μs,以1Gb/s速率工作,10μs可发送的比特数等于:

10×10-6×1×109=10000bit=1250字节。

3-24假定站点A和B在同一个10Mbps以太网网段上。这两个站点之间的传播时延为225比特时间,现假定A开始发送一帧,并且在A发送结束前B也发送一帧。如果A发送的是以太网所容许的最短的帧,那么A在检测到和B发生碰撞之前能否把自己的数据发送完毕?换言之,如果A在发送完毕之前并没有检测到碰撞,那么能否肯定A所发送的帧不会和B发送的帧发生碰撞?(考虑前同步码和帧定界符)解答:A发送的是以太网所容许的最短帧,所以A在t=0时刻开始发送,则在t=576比特时间(发送(64+8)字节)A应当发送完毕。当A检测到和B发生碰撞时,最多需要450比特时间,所以A检测到和B发生碰撞之前数据还没有发送完。如果A在发送完毕之前没有检测到碰撞,可以肯定A所发送的帧就不会和B发送的帧发生碰撞。3-32发送的帧地址接口地址接口B1的处理B2的处理A-EA1A1转发,登记转发,登记C-BC2C1转发,登记转发,登记D-CD2D2登记,丢弃登记,转发B-AB1登记,丢弃接收不到B1的转发表B2的转发表

4-9解答:(1)可以代表C类地址对应的子网掩码默认值;也能表示A类和B类地址的掩码,前24位决定网络号和子网号,后8位决定主机号.(用24bit表示网络部分地址,包括网络号和子网号)(2)48化成二进制序列为:11111111111111111111111111111000,根据掩码的定义,后三位是主机号,一共可以表示8个主机号,除掉全0和全1的两个,该网络能够接6个主机.(3)子网掩码的形式是一样的,都是;但是子网的数目不一样,前者为65534,后者为254.(4)化成二进制序列为:11111111111111111111000000000000。后12位表示主机号,所以每一个子网上的主机数目最多是4096-2=4094(5)有效,但不推荐使用。(6)29C类地址

(7)有,可以提高网络利用率。实际环境中可能存在将C类网网络地址进一步划分为子网的情况,需要掩码说明子网号的划分。C类网参加互连网的路由,也应该使用子网掩码进行统一的IP路由运算。4-20设某路由器建立了如下路由表:现共收到3个分组的,其目的地址分别是:(1)0(2)2(3)7试分别计算其下一跳。目的网络子网掩码下一跳28接口m02828接口m028R292R3*(默认)-R4

4-21某单位分配到一个B类IP地址,其net-id为,该单位有4000台机器,分布在16个不同的地点。如选用子网掩码为,试给每一个地点分配一个子网号码,并算出每个地点主机号码的最小值和最大值。解答:B类地址

网络号为129.250

子网掩码

则用8位表示子网号,可表示256个子网.

若该单位划分16个子网,则从中取出16个号表示16个子网即可.如—.

每个地点主机号码可为1—254.

子网号子网网络号

主机IP的最小值和最大值1:00000001

---54

2:

00000010

---54

3:

00000011

---54

4:

00000100

---54

5:

00000101

---54

6:

00000110

---54

7:

00000111

---54

8:

00001000

---54

9:

00001001

---54

10:

00001010

---54

11:

00001011

---54

12:

00001100

---54

13:

00001101

---54

14:

00001110

---54

15:

00001111

---54

16:

00010000

---54

4-26有如下的4个/24地址块,试进行最大可能的聚合。

/24/24/24/24

解答:212.56.13210000100133100001011341000011013510000111

共同的前缀是22位所以最大可能的聚合是

/224-29一个自治系统有5个局域网,其连接图如图所示。LAN2至LAN5上的主机数分别为91,150,3和15.该自治系统分配到的IP地址为30.138.118/23.试给出每一个局域网的地址块(包括前缀)。解答:地址块30.138.118/23可写成/23

写成二进制表示:00011110

10001010

01110110

00000000

网络前缀23位,主机号9位.

分配网络前缀时应先分配地址数较多的前缀。

LAN3有150个主机加一个路由器地址为151个地址。

在地址块00011110

10001010

0111011*

********中

分配地址

00011110

10001010

01110110

********

/24

(或/24)LAN2有91个主机加一个路由器地址为92个地址。

分配地址

00011110

10001010

01110111

0*******

/25(或/25)LAN5有15个主机加一个路由器地址为16个地址。分配地址

00011110

10001010

01110111

10******

28/26LAN4有3个主机加一个路由器地址为4个地址。分配地址

00011110

10001010

01110111

11001***

00/29LAN1至少有3个IP地址供路由器用。也分一个/29地址块

分配地址

00011110

10001010

01110111

11000***

92/29

4-31以下地址中哪一个和86.32/12匹配?请说明理由。(1)23(2)16(3)4(4)54解答:86.32/1286.00100000第(1)个是匹配的。4-37某单位分配到一个地址块4/26。现在需要进一步划分为4个一样大的子网。问:(1)每个子网的网络前缀有多长?(2)每一个子网中有多少个地址?(3)每一个子网的地址块是什么?(4)每一个子网可分配给主机使用的最小地址和最大地址是什么?解答(1)28位

(2)16个地址

(3)第一个子网4/285/28----8/28

第二个子网0/281/28----4/28

第三个子网6/287/28----10/28

第四个子网12/2813/28----26/281000000/2801000001--010011101010000/281100000/281110000/28某单位分配到一个地址块28/25。现需要进一步划分为3个子网,其中第1个子网能容纳50台主机,另外两个子网均能容纳20台主机,请给出每个子网的地址块。4-41解答:B收到从C发来的路由信息,对此路由信息进行修改,得到

N25CN39CN65CN84CN96C路由器B更新后的路由表如下:

N1

7

A无新信息,不改变

N2

5

C相同的下一跳,更新

N3

9

C新的项目,添加进来

N6

5

C不同的下一跳,距离更短,更新

N8

4

E不同的下一跳,距离一样,不改变

N9

4

F不同的下一跳,距离更大,不改变

5-14一个UDP用户数据报的首部的十六进制表示是:06320045001CE217。试求源端口、目的端口、用户数据报的总长度、数据部分长度?这个数据报是从客户发送给服务器还是从服务器发送给客户?使用UDP的这个服务器程序是什么?源端口号:1586,目的端口:69;UDP用户数据报总长度28字节,数据部分长度20字节。此UDP用户数据报是从客户发给服务器(因为目的端口号<1023,是熟知端口)。服务器程序是TFTP.源端口目的端口长度检验和22225-23

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论